Onto the $4 trillion stage?

Financial experts have predicted that online retail giant Amazon could achieve a market capitalization of $4 trillion by 2025, leaving its competitors in the dust. In other words, if other companies in the stock market aren't having a record-breaking year in 2025, Amazon will be worth more than any other company in the world. But what makes this prediction more than just hot air? After all, Amazon's stock has only barely outperformed the US S&P 500 index in the past five years. Many eyes are on Amazon Web Services (AWS) as the driving force behind this astronomical growth.

In the second quarter of 2023, AWS sustained a 12% year-over-year growth, while managing a staggering 19% year-over-year increase by the third quarter of 2024. Some experts believe that AI demand will remain strong in 2025, fueling AWS's engine of growth. If revenue surges by approximately 25% in 2025, as these experts anticipate, AWS's total revenue could soar to around $130 billion.

Sizing up Amazon's stock

It's easy to lose sight of Amazon's core business in all the commotion. Make no mistake, e-commerce, subscriptions, and advertising continue to generate a combined $377 billion in North America alone, with an additional $140 billion coming from international operations. Amazon is also venturing into new markets such as India, which promises a lucrative future.

Wall Street analysts are optimistic about Amazon's stock. Out of 49 analysts who track the stock, 48 recommend buying it. The average price target hovers around $250, promising an upside of almost 15%. Although this is paltry compared to Nvidia, it's worth noting that recent analyses from Morgan Stanley and HSBC have increased their price targets to $280 and $270, respectively, in January. The big question: Can Amazon reach $4 trillion by 2025?

While Amazon shows immense potential for growth, reaching a market capitalization of $4 trillion by 2025 would require remarkable achievements across all its business segments. Current forecasts do not suggest such a rapid increase; however, Amazon has the ability to surprise us, just as it has done in the past. The future is bright for this technological titan.
